Transaction 17a1871d06a81bd91d7048d0be4e5b2fa03e5fec171237989958dd6ec103bf4a

1 Input
2 Outputs
  • 17a1871d06a81bd91d7048d0be4e5b2fa03e5fec171237989958dd6ec103bf4a:0
  • value  313766
    address  16YHXHyPGmz1jz94Up6Aq2hhWCVFtkg9va
  • 17a1871d06a81bd91d7048d0be4e5b2fa03e5fec171237989958dd6ec103bf4a:1
  • value  253180688
    address  3Qf4e6MMSnteTVE1xuMr5y5Mdimh7Ghqsy